What should I know about getting a visa to visit Italy from the USA?

🇺🇸 United States🇮🇹 Italy

Short answer

U.S. citizens can visit Italy for up to 90 days without a visa for tourism. For longer stays or other purposes, a visa is required. Always check the latest regulations before planning your trip, as rules can change.
